St Therese Catholic Church sits on North Tahoe Trail in the eastern stretch of Sioux Falls, and it carries the kind of settled, grounded energy that comes from a parish that actually knows its people.
As a Catholic church serving the surrounding neighborhoods, St. Therese holds regular Mass, administers the sacraments — baptism, confirmation, reconciliation, marriage, anointing of the sick — and runs religious education programs for children and adults alike. Pastoral care here isn't a department; it's the thread running through everything, from RCIA for those entering the faith to ongoing formation for lifelong Catholics.
